app_telecommunication_img1Telecommunications equipment play one of the most important roles in our society. When telecommunication and broadcast facilities go off-line not only are day-to-day communications halted for its users but critical services such as ambulance, fire, and police resources and responses are also compromised.

Critical telecommunication positions need surge protection not only for AC power supply, but also for communication lines and DC panels. Telecommunications equipment are vulnerable to lightning induced surges, and transients caused by switching components producing electrical noise in power supply.

Focuses on tracking the waveform and filtering the pollution generated in power network supply is the most important part in the protection of sophisticated telecommunication equipment . This pollution equals losses, unreliable performance, decrease asset life-spans, increase maintenance and downtime.

The problems of grounding pollution generated by electrical equipment inside the facility (3.5kHz-1MHz) is also the serious problem in the “New Electronic World” expecially for successful functioning of telecom equipment.

That new power network “ disease” have negative impact on functioning and reliability of telecommunication equipment.

The option for ground filtering annuls all disadvantages of high frequency resonance in grounding system.

The ground filtering prevents the ground loops, reduces feedback to sensitive electronic form ground and reduced the chance of equipment damage caused by near-strike lightning.
